Overview
Dr. James Sipkins, MD is a highly experienced internist and geriatrician practicing in Chicago, Illinois, with over 41 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from the University of Minnesota Medical School in 1982 and completed his residency at Northwestern Memorial Hospital. Dr. Sipkins is affiliated with both Northwestern Memorial Hospital and Northwestern Medicine, ensuring a strong network of support for his patients....
